On Wed, 7 Dec 2005, David S. Madole wrote:

> Of course, I see that now, not sure how I missed it. So it looks like I have
> two options if I want this to work:
> 
> 1. Set the host using the router option instead of a transport option.
> 
> 2. Modify deliver.c to print the host information for local transports from
> host_used if it is set, like it already does for remote transports.
> 
> Seems like the second option is the better choice. Thanks for the help.

3. Make your transport a remote transport. After all, if it is 
delivering over IMAP to another host, surely it *is* a remote transport,
not a local transport?
